Rabbit Food Tractor Supply: Why Focus is Vital in Modern Agriculture?

Rabbits are increasingly a staple for sustainable rural systems in 2026. Their small size, fast reproduction rates, adaptability, and high meat yield make them a popular choice for homesteading and commercial farming alike. However, rabbit health and productivity hinge on providing precise nutrition tailored to their unique digestive biology.

  • High fiber intake supports gut health and digestive efficiency
  • Balanced protein levels promote muscle and tissue development
  • Essential vitamins and minerals boost immunity and reproductive rates
  • Premium pellets and hay ensure dental health and comfort
  • Diversified feed options enable nutrition customization for different life stages

Pro Tip:
When switching rabbit feed types or pellets, introduce new products gradually over 10–14 days to prevent digestive disturbances in your rabbits. Monitor for changes in appetite and stool consistency for optimal health management.

Rabbit Pellets at Tractor Supply: Premium Nutrition Explained

Tractor Supply rabbit pellets lead the market for their balanced composition and specialized nutrition. So, what makes an ideal rabbit pellet in 2026?

  • Crude fiber content exceeding 15% for digestive and dental health
  • 📊 Protein levels of 16–18% to fuel growth and maintenance
  • Rich in essential vitamins (A, D, E) and minerals for immune support
  • Low calcium for adult rabbits to prevent urinary issues, but higher for lactating does
  • 📊 Absence of artificial colors, flavors, and unnecessary fillers
  • Packed with fresh, sustainable hay or timothy as a base ingredient

Balanced Nutrition for Goats: Why It Matters

  • IDietary needs differ by breed (dairy, meat, or fiber), age, and reproductive status
  • Balanced protein (14–18%), fats, and carbohydrates in specialized pellets support productivity and immunity
  • 📊 Essential minerals (calcium, phosphorus, selenium) are vital for milk quality, reproductive and skeletal health
  • High roughage digestibility prevents bloat and metabolic issues
  • Addition of prebiotics and probiotics enhances gut health and feed conversion

Common Mistake:
Do not overfeed mineral mixes or protein supplements to goats. Instead, follow manufacturer guidelines and consult with a veterinarian to ensure the nutritional needs are optimally met without causing toxicity or metabolic imbalance.

Expert Tips & Key Insights for Animal Nutrition

  • Rotate feed types periodically and monitor animal health to optimize diet effectiveness over time.
  • 📊 Track feed usage and animal productivity with digital or satellite tools for data-driven decision making.
  • Store feed in a cool, dry place to prevent spoilage and nutrient degradation, maximizing investment returns.
  • Tailor feed blends to age, reproductive status, and seasonal changes for best results.
